Output 9ec92667f5d3234b855950c346434a66b384cb3066360a108bc7670d95a02cfa:0

value
584990000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 280cdc28c8b22f06a84a9645fbd5c5cbd0e78704 OP_EQUALVERIFY OP_CHECKSIG
address
14emSCgq3goM93vApJUMoafGQ8NrysjPuc
transaction
9ec92667f5d3234b855950c346434a66b384cb3066360a108bc7670d95a02cfa
spent
true